Swiss Army Knives

I've been a fan of Swiss Army knives for years and have a few that I carry on a daily basis. My Swiss Army Explorer is my favorite but the handle scales are getting a little loose. You used to be able to find replacement scales online but I'm not having luck finding any lately. I can find the usual replacement toothpicks and tweezers. Does anyone know of a source for replacement scales?

Q. Can you send me scales?
A. No, we do not send scales but you can send your knife in to have the knife handles replaced free of charge.
